Pentagon Bans Soldiers from Using GPS Apps and Devices

After fitness apps have been shown to reveal the locations of U.S. military personnel in hot zones around the world, the Pentagon is mandating that armed service members must switch off any device using GPS functionality if they are deployed in “operational areas.” “Effective immediately, Defense...

Many Health and Fitness Apps Remain Vulnerable

It seems little has changed over the last several years when it comes to how health and fitness apps go about securing user information. According to a survey carried out by the firm Arxan last fall, 86 percent of health apps it reviewed at had at least two critical vulnerabilities and 55 percent...
